Question 933128: Write an equation that expresses side l as a function of the area A and the perimeter P. What must be the relationship between P and A if this equation has a real solution?
So far, I've determined that A/w=l. I can replace w with ((P/2)-l). However, I don't know what to do from there. Found 2 solutions by Alan3354, ewatrrr:Answer by Alan3354(69443) (Show Source):

If this is a rectangle:
Area = L*W --> W = A/L
P = 2L + 2W --> L = (P - 2W)/2
L = P/2 - A/L
L^2 = PL/2 - A
2L^2 - PL + A = 0
